Can Telematics Reduce Your Rig Insurance in South Carolina?

Telematics allows a trucking business to remotely monitor the locations and behavior of their fleet of trucks. Each truck has an installed wireless device that communicates information such as location, speed, acceleration, deceleration, motor rpm, time of day, and other data back to a trucking fleet manager. Owner Operator Insurance in South Carolina: About Primary Liability Insurance

If you plan to be an owner operator truck driver in South Carolina, your most basic insurance necessity will be primary liability insurance. Without it, you cannot drive your truck because federal and state law requires it. This insurance covers you in accidents for which you are at fault.
